I normally use dvd43 and 1 click dvd copy to make my backups. However dvd43 was unable to decode re2 and I just got the forgotten, so I downloaded anydvd for my trial version to see if this would work (according to what i've been reading, it seems to what everyone uses & one of the best). The problem is that I think I'm using it wrong. The fox icon is on the desktop and when I put the movie in, an info window comes up & looks like all is well. Then I click start on 1 click & I get the same message that I was getting with dvd43 - "The DVD contains bad sectors. The error is due to a copy protection scheme on the original DVD. 1click dvd copy does not remove copy protection". Please help, I'm sure it's just that I don't really know what I'm doing. When you click on the fox icon on the desktop you should see another one in the system tray near the clock time. That tells you Anydvd is ready. If the fox is not in the system tray it isn't activated.

the fox is in the system tray and it says that it is enabled & I still get that message. Any other ideas?

Try another copy program using AnyDVD. It will work with just about any out there. Use DVD Shrink while AnyDVD is running or Nero Recode. AnyDVD was designed to work best with Clonedvd2, but because it runs in the background it works with most others. There is also a trial download of Clonedvd2.
